Title: Innovations and Contributions of William M. Sweeney
Introduction: William M. Sweeney, a notable inventor based in Wappingers Falls, NY, has made significant strides in the field of lubricant technology, holding an impressive total of 46 patents. His work centers around enhancing the performance and efficiency of gasoline crankcase lubricants, contributing to improved engine functionality.
Latest Patents: Among his latest patents, Sweeney has developed a gasoline crankcase lubricant that enhances the friction-modifying properties of oil through the incorporation of a specialized friction modifier. This compound consists of dialkoxylated alkyl polyoxyalkyl amines, where R can be a hydrocarbyl radical ranging from C1 to C20, and other components are tailored to optimize oil performance.
Another key patent involves a detergent and corrosion-inhibiting additive and motor fuel composition, which describes a novel compound aimed at improving fuel quality and engine protection. This compound features various hydrocarbon and alkoxy substituted hydrocarbon radicals, designed to enhance the overall efficacy of motor fuels.
